#include
void fun(int x,int pp[],int *n)
{
int i=1,j=0,k=0,*t=pp;
for(i=0;i<=x;i++)
{
if(i%2!=0)
{
t[j] = i;
j++;
}
}
for(i=0;i
{
pp[k] = t[i];
k++;
}
*n =k;
for(i = 0 ; i < j ; i++)
printf("%d ",pp[i]);
printf("\n");
}
int main()
{
int x,n,pp[10000];
printf("请输入x的值(<0x<10000):\n");
scanf("%d",&x);
fun(x,pp,&n);
printf("%d\n",n);
return 0;
}